The CERH European Women's Roller Hockey Juvenile Championship is a competition between the female juvenile national teams in the Europe. It takes place every two years and it is organized by CERH. The first edition is not considered official. Its disputed by U-17 female players.
Winners
Ladies Championship
Year | Ed | Host city | Gold | Silver | Bronze |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
2024 | 2nd | Olot, Spain | Spain | Portugal | France |
2023 | 1st | Correggio, Italy | Portugal | England | Italy |
2014 | *– | Darmstadt, Germany | |||
2013 | *– | Wuppertal, Germany | France | Germany 1 | Germany 2 |
* Non official editions
